Located in Southeast Kelowna, Tantalus Vineyards has been producing internationally recognized wines from our 75-acre estate vineyard in British Columbia's Okanagan Valley since 2005. Farming one of BC's oldest, continuously producing vineyards (the property has been growing grapes since 1927), we have a strong commitment to land stewardship and sustainability. Our state-of-the-art, LEED-certified winery is the first and only of its kind in BC and most recently we underwent the rigorous Sustainable Winegrowing BC Certification for both our vineyard and winery. Our focus is on a small, terroir-driven line of wines, crafted primarily from estate grown Riesling, Chardonnay and Pinot Noir, with vines dating back to 1978.
